Saving and Recalling Snapshots

Saving a snapshot
As an example, to save a snapshot on the M/E-1 bank,
proceed as follows.
1
In the M/E-1 bank, make the settings for the state you
want to save as a snapshot.
2
In the Flexi Pad, press the [SNAPSHOT] button,
turning it on.
This switches the memory recall section to snapshot
operation mode.
The alphanumeric display shows the number of the
last recalled register on the bank.
3
Press the region selection button corresponding to the
region for which you want to save, turning it on.
You can select more than one button.

4
Press the [BANK SEL] button, and select the desired
bank with the register you want to save.
For details about the method of bank selection,
1 "Banks and Registers" (p.
5
Hold down the [SNAPSHOT] button, and press the
button in the memory recall section corresponding to
the register in which you want to save.
Notes
If you press a button which is lit orange or yellow, this
overwrites the contents of the corresponding register.
The button you pressed is lit yellow, and this
completes saving.
